
Excel公式调用字段的方法主要包括:直接引用单元格、使用命名范围、使用表格结构引用。这些方法各有优劣,具体使用哪一种取决于你的需求。
例如,直接引用单元格最为简单直观,但当数据量较大或结构复杂时,命名范围和表格结构引用可能更为有效。接下来,我们将详细探讨这些方法及其应用场景。
一、直接引用单元格
直接引用单元格是最基础也是最常见的调用字段的方法。通过在公式中直接引用单元格,可以快速实现数据的计算和分析。
1.1、基本用法
在Excel中,直接在公式中输入单元格的地址即可。例如,要计算A1和B1的和,可以在C1中输入公式=A1+B1。这样,C1就会显示A1和B1的和。
1.2、相对引用与绝对引用
在Excel中,引用单元格时,可以使用相对引用或绝对引用。相对引用会随着公式所在单元格的位置变化而变化,而绝对引用则是固定的。
- 相对引用:例如,在C1中输入公式
=A1+B1,当将C1的公式复制到C2时,公式会自动变为=A2+B2。 - 绝对引用:在公式中使用美元符号
$来固定行或列。例如,在C1中输入公式=$A$1+B1,当将C1的公式复制到C2时,公式会变为=$A$1+B2。
1.3、混合引用
混合引用是指固定行或列中的一个。例如,公式=$A1+B$1,当将其复制到C2时,会变为=$A2+B$1,这意味着列A是固定的,而行1是固定的。
二、使用命名范围
命名范围是一种更为灵活和易于管理的方法,特别是当数据量较大或结构复杂时。通过给一组单元格命名,可以在公式中直接使用名称,而无需每次都输入单元格地址。
2.1、定义命名范围
要定义命名范围,可以按照以下步骤操作:
- 选择要命名的单元格范围。
- 在Excel菜单中,选择“公式”选项卡。
- 点击“定义名称”按钮。
- 在弹出的对话框中,输入名称并点击“确定”。
2.2、使用命名范围
定义命名范围后,可以在公式中直接使用。例如,假设你定义了一个名为Sales的范围,可以在公式中输入=SUM(Sales)来计算该范围内所有单元格的和。
2.3、管理命名范围
命名范围可以通过Excel中的“名称管理器”进行管理。通过名称管理器,可以查看、编辑和删除命名范围。
三、使用表格结构引用
Excel中的表格结构引用是一种更为结构化和动态的方法。通过将数据转换为表格,可以在公式中使用结构化引用,这样在数据发生变化时,公式会自动调整。
3.1、创建表格
要创建表格,可以按照以下步骤操作:
- 选择包含数据的单元格范围。
- 在Excel菜单中,选择“插入”选项卡。
- 点击“表格”按钮。
- 在弹出的对话框中,确认选择的范围并点击“确定”。
3.2、使用结构化引用
创建表格后,可以在公式中使用表格的列名来引用。例如,假设你创建了一个包含销售数据的表格,并将其命名为SalesTable,可以在公式中输入=SUM(SalesTable[SalesAmount])来计算销售金额列的总和。
3.3、自动调整
使用表格结构引用的一个重要优势是,当表格中的数据发生变化时,引用会自动调整。例如,当添加或删除表格中的行时,使用结构化引用的公式会自动更新。
四、Excel公式中的常见函数
在Excel中,可以使用多种函数来调用和计算字段。这些函数可以分为数学函数、统计函数、逻辑函数和文本函数等类别。
4.1、数学函数
数学函数用于执行基本的数学运算。例如:
- SUM:计算一组数的总和。例如,
=SUM(A1:A10)。 - AVERAGE:计算一组数的平均值。例如,
=AVERAGE(A1:A10)。 - MIN/MAX:计算一组数中的最小值和最大值。例如,
=MIN(A1:A10)和=MAX(A1:A10)。
4.2、统计函数
统计函数用于执行统计分析。例如:
- COUNT/COUNTA:计算一组单元格中的数值或非空单元格的数量。例如,
=COUNT(A1:A10)和=COUNTA(A1:A10)。 - MEDIAN:计算一组数的中位数。例如,
=MEDIAN(A1:A10)。 - STDEV:计算一组数的标准差。例如,
=STDEV(A1:A10)。
4.3、逻辑函数
逻辑函数用于执行逻辑判断。例如:
- IF:根据条件返回不同的值。例如,
=IF(A1>10, "Yes", "No")。 - AND/OR:用于多个条件的逻辑与或逻辑或。例如,
=AND(A1>10, B1<20)和=OR(A1>10, B1<20)。 - NOT:用于反转逻辑条件。例如,
=NOT(A1>10)。
4.4、文本函数
文本函数用于处理文本数据。例如:
- CONCATENATE:连接多个文本字符串。例如,
=CONCATENATE(A1, B1)。 - LEFT/RIGHT/MID:提取文本字符串中的部分内容。例如,
=LEFT(A1, 3)、=RIGHT(A1, 3)和=MID(A1, 2, 3)。 - LEN:计算文本字符串的长度。例如,
=LEN(A1)。
五、Excel公式的高级应用
在实际应用中,Excel公式可以结合多种函数和方法,实现更为复杂和高级的数据分析和处理。
5.1、数组公式
数组公式可以一次性处理多个值,并返回一个结果或多个结果。例如,计算两个数组的乘积和,可以使用数组公式=SUM(A1:A10*B1:B10),并按Ctrl+Shift+Enter键确认。
5.2、条件格式
通过条件格式,可以根据单元格的值自动应用格式。例如,使用公式=A1>10可以将大于10的单元格自动设置为特定颜色。
5.3、数据透视表
数据透视表是一种强大的工具,可以用于动态汇总和分析大量数据。通过将数据源转换为数据透视表,可以快速生成各种统计报表。
5.4、宏与VBA
通过使用宏和VBA(Visual Basic for Applications),可以实现自动化操作和复杂的数据处理。例如,可以编写VBA代码来自动化数据的导入、清洗和分析过程。
六、常见问题与解决方案
在使用Excel公式调用字段时,可能会遇到一些常见问题。以下是一些常见问题及其解决方案。
6.1、公式错误
当公式中包含错误时,Excel会显示错误信息。例如,#VALUE!表示公式中的数据类型不匹配,#DIV/0!表示除数为零。可以使用IFERROR函数来处理这些错误,例如,=IFERROR(A1/B1, "Error")。
6.2、循环引用
循环引用是指公式中包含对自身的引用。Excel会显示警告信息,并可能导致计算结果不正确。可以通过检查和修改公式来解决循环引用问题。
6.3、数据更新
当数据源发生变化时,公式可能需要更新。例如,当表格中的数据被删除或添加时,使用结构化引用的公式会自动更新,但直接引用单元格的公式可能需要手动调整。
七、总结
Excel公式调用字段的方法多种多样,适用于不同的应用场景。直接引用单元格适合简单的计算,命名范围适合较大或结构复杂的数据,表格结构引用适合动态数据。 通过结合使用各种函数和高级应用,Excel可以实现强大的数据分析和处理功能。在实际操作中,合理选择和应用这些方法,可以大大提高工作效率和数据处理能力。
无论是初学者还是高级用户,都可以通过不断学习和实践,掌握Excel公式调用字段的技巧和方法,从而在工作和生活中更好地利用这一强大的工具。
相关问答FAQs:
1. 如何在Excel中调用字段?
在Excel中,可以使用公式来调用字段。以下是一些常用的方法:
-
通过引用单元格调用字段: 在公式中使用单元格引用来调用字段。例如,如果要调用A1单元格中的字段,可以在公式中输入
=A1。 -
使用表格引用调用字段: 如果在Excel中使用了数据表格,可以使用表格引用来调用字段。例如,如果要调用表格中的姓名字段,可以在公式中输入
=表格名称[姓名]。 -
使用函数调用字段: Excel提供了许多函数来处理字段数据。可以使用这些函数来调用字段并进行计算、筛选等操作。例如,可以使用SUM函数来计算某个字段的总和,使用AVERAGE函数来计算某个字段的平均值。
2. 如何在Excel中调用多个字段?
在Excel中,可以使用公式来调用多个字段,并进行复杂的计算和分析。以下是一些常用的方法:
-
使用运算符调用多个字段: 可以使用加号、减号、乘号、除号等运算符来调用多个字段并进行计算。例如,可以使用
=A1+B1来调用A1和B1单元格中的字段并进行相加。 -
使用函数调用多个字段: Excel提供了许多函数来处理多个字段数据。可以使用这些函数来调用多个字段并进行复杂的计算、筛选等操作。例如,可以使用IF函数来根据条件调用不同的字段。
3. 如何在Excel中调用特定条件下的字段?
在Excel中,可以使用公式来调用特定条件下的字段。以下是一些常用的方法:
-
使用IF函数调用特定条件下的字段: IF函数可以根据条件来选择调用不同的字段。例如,可以使用
=IF(A1>10, B1, C1)来在A1大于10时调用B1字段,在A1小于等于10时调用C1字段。 -
使用FILTER函数调用特定条件下的字段: FILTER函数可以根据条件来筛选调用特定的字段。例如,可以使用
=FILTER(A1:C10, A1:A10>10)来调用满足条件的A1:C10范围内的字段。 -
使用VLOOKUP函数调用特定条件下的字段: VLOOKUP函数可以根据条件在某个范围内查找并调用字段。例如,可以使用
=VLOOKUP(A1, B1:C10, 2, FALSE)来在B1:C10范围内根据A1的值调用第二列的字段。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4367885